Book Description:

UNDER HIS WINGS

Unprecedented violence is erupting not only in far-away places like the Middle East, but also nearby in the parking lots of big-box stores and the pews of worshipping believers. Society at war is nearing a tipping point.

Parallels, from the unspeakable chaos of Europe enflamed in WW II to our own perplexing times, are striking as we see every-day Calvinists, in solidarity with the least of these, burning in the furnace, discovering a fourth man in the fire, and emerging without a hint of smoke on their long white robes.

Dedicated to Charles Spurgeon and Martyn Lloyd-Jones-this book will touch your heart and point your family to a hiding place from the harrowing days pounding on our own front doors.

Author:

In addition to publishing numerous outstanding books, Christine Farenhorst is also a columnist for Reformed Perspective and a contributing writer for Christian Renewal. She and her husband, Anco, have FIve children, nineteen grandchildren, a dog, and twelve chickens.
